    Baron Charlie Lush, MA, FLCM Encouraged by a fellow Art History student
    at St Andrews University, UK, artist and author Baron Charlie Lush took
    up the brush in 2002. Since then, he has completed over three hundred
    oil paintings. He was recently interviewed on UK television about his
    large-scale political satire ‘The Iraq War at Home’ then on display at
    the Glasgow School of Art. Inspired by the work of Edvard Munch, John
    Brakewell Baldwin and Samuel Peploe, his larger canvases typically
    contain elements of passion and solitude, reflective observation and
    vibrant colour. He
    paints what he likeswhen he likes without being bound either by
    convention or the urge to deny it. Consequently, his range of subject
    matter and execution is both as vital and diverse as every experience
    derived from his art.
